
Diane Brewster
Biography
From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ia Diane Brewster (March 11, 1931 – November 12, 1991) was an American actress most noted for playing three distinctively different roles in television series of the 1950s and 1960s: confidence trickster Samantha Crawford in the western Maverick; pretty young second-grade teacher Miss Canfield in Leave It to Beaver; and doomed wife Helen Kimble in The Fugitive.
